Ciao ho creato una classe di un oggetto 'anagrafica' ma il compilatore mi da errore in run dicendomi 'Ambiguous name detected'.
Qualcuno può darmi una mano?

codice:
'Classe per gestire un oggetto di tipo Anagrafica

Private cod_anagrafica As String
Private rag_sociale As String
......

'Metodo costruttore
Friend Sub init(cod_an As String, Optional rag_sociale As String, Optional indirizzo As String, Optional cap As String, Optional localita As String)
    Me.cod_anagrafica = cod_an
    If Not IsMissing(rag_sociale) Then
        Me.rag_sociale = rag_sociale
    End If
    ......
    .....
End Sub

Public Property Get cod_anagrafica() As String
    cod_an = Me.cod_anagrafica
End Property

Public Property Let cod_anagrafica(ByVal vNewValue As String)
    If (vNewValue = "") Then
        Err.Raise 5
    Else
        Me.cod_anagrafica = vNewValue
    End If
End Property

......
.......